Course Aims | ||||||||
This course aims to introduce to students how Chinese is learned and taught as a foreign language in global contexts. The approaches to foreign language acquisition and teaching will be compared and contrasted. Research on learning and teaching Chinese as a foreign language will be reviewed for the purposes of enhancing Chinese learning and teaching in global contexts. | ||||||||
Assessment (Indicative only, please check the detailed course information) | ||||||||
Tutorial or take-home short assignments: 25% A paper on Error Analysis: 35% Semester-end project: 40% (30% written project, 10% oral presentation) | ||||||||
